Set in an almost forgotten guerrilla war in what is now called Zimbabwe during the 1970s this is a journey into the world of young men fighting and dying at the behest of their political masters. The strain of having to survive close-quarter skirmishes preoccupy the combatants who helplessly find themselves caught up in a conflict spinning out of control.Mike Smith an insecure nineteen-year old national serviceman is immersed in a bloody insurgency witnessing horrors that seem too much for a young man to have to bear.Tongerai Chabanga a commander of the liberation movement must withstand political pressure from his leaders outside the country to prosecute the war in a manner he disagrees with. At the same time he is faced with the atrocities perpetrated of a depraved Soviet Spetznaz advisor who threatens to undo the work he has done.
